源代码//父类Parentclass Parent{ int x; int y; Parent() { x = 0; y = 0; } public void Set(int a,int b) { x = a; ...
分类:
其他好文 时间:
2015-11-06 11:05:25
阅读次数:
150
以下为使用BaseAdapter作扩展,自定义Adapter来使用ListView控件:需要注意以下的几点:1、自定义Adapter时,需要特别注意Adapter类中getView()方法覆盖,注意加载布局文件和加载控件的区别;2、自定义好Adapter后,在Activity中实现ListView的...
分类:
其他好文 时间:
2015-10-16 15:16:28
阅读次数:
244
@Override是JDK5 就已经有了,但有个小小的Bug,就是不支持对接口的实现,认为这不是Override而JDK6 修正了这个Bug,无论是对父类的方法覆盖还是对接口的实现都可以加上@Override我想这个问题肯定困扰了很多人,我也不例外。新公司用的东西多多少少会与我们以前公司的有所不同。...
分类:
其他好文 时间:
2015-10-09 22:53:28
阅读次数:
238
重构重写和重载的区别:重写:1.父类与子类之间的多态性,对父类的函数进行重新定义。如果在子类中定义某方法与其父类有相同的名称和参数,我们说该方法被重写 。方法重写又称方法覆盖。2.若子类中的方法与父类中的某一方法具有相同的方法名、返回类型和参数表,则新方法将覆盖原有的方法。3.子类函数的访问修饰权限...
分类:
Web程序 时间:
2015-09-25 07:04:04
阅读次数:
141
一、通过js实现页面加载完毕执行代码的方式与jquery的区别 1、通过jquery的方式可以 让多个方法被执行,而通过window.onload的方式只能执行最后一个, 因为最后一次注册的方法会把前面的方法覆盖掉 1、 window.onload需要等待页面的所有元素资源比如说img里的图片一些连...
分类:
Web程序 时间:
2015-09-09 22:50:22
阅读次数:
300
1.spring AOP 会忽略切面类从父类继承的方法,除非在切面类,也就是子类中对父类方法覆盖@Override. package com.skyline.dao;@Repositorypublic class A{ public void a(){ //implements.... }...
分类:
编程语言 时间:
2015-09-08 18:10:00
阅读次数:
521
方法重载和方法覆盖
请带着下面两点来看文章:
覆盖即重写,覆盖不等于重载,即重写不等于重载。
覆盖(重写)蕴含继承性,而重载只能在本类中使用,不含继承。
方法名和参数列表的比较
方法覆盖中的方法名和参数
首先创建基类Shape:
public class Shape { public void draw() {...
分类:
编程语言 时间:
2015-08-26 22:21:45
阅读次数:
233
1. 方法重写 方法重写(overiding method) 在Java中,子类可继承父类中的方法,而不需要重新编写相同的方法。但有时子类并不想原封不动地继承父类的方法,而是想作一定的修改,这就需要采用方法 的重写。方法重写又称方法覆盖。 若子类中的方法与父类中的某一方法具有相同的方法名、返回类.....
分类:
其他好文 时间:
2015-08-19 16:07:56
阅读次数:
109
今天看了下有关java注解的视频学习资料在,做点笔记:
学java注解的目的:
能看别人代码,特别是框架代码,因为肯定与注解有关。
编程更简洁,代码清晰。
java注解是java1.5引入的:注解概念是java提供的一种原程序中的元素关联任何信息和元数据的途径和方法。
常见注解(编译时注解);
@override:方法覆盖了它的父类的方法
@Deprecated:这个...
分类:
编程语言 时间:
2015-08-08 15:01:22
阅读次数:
158
概念:java提供了一种原程序中的元素关联任何信息和任何元数据的途径和方法
JDK内置系统注解:
@Override 用于修饰此方法覆盖了父类的方法;
@Deprecated 用于修饰已经过时的方法;
@Suppvisewarnings 用于通知java编译器禁止特定的编译警告。
注解按照运行机制划分
源码注解:注解只在源码中存在,编译成.class文件就不存在了;
编译时注解:注...
分类:
编程语言 时间:
2015-08-01 20:38:15
阅读次数:
115